; Launch Reflects Concern About 18-24-Year-Olds Without Work

Summary


A NEW campaign to tackle youth unemployment and give young people better opportunities to get into the world of work is being launched in the Bristol area.

The campaign will be launched by the Bristol Partnership, a group that involves the business, public, community and voluntary sectors, as well as education organisations, to make Bristol more successful.
